07/11/2025 Duración: 55minHugues de ThéCollège de FranceOncologie cellulaire et moléculaireAnnée 2025-2026Hematopoietic Stem Cell through the Ages: A Lifetime of Adaptation to Organismal DemandsConférence - Emmanuelle Passegué : Principle of Hematopoietic Stem Cell Biology and Blood ProductionEmmanuelle PasseguéDirectrice de la Columbia Stem Cell Initiative et professeure émérite de génétique et de développement à l'université ColumbiaRésuméUnlike most adult organs, the blood system regenerates continuously to maintain homeostasis in a life-long process orchestrated by a complex collection of hematopoietic stem and progenitor cells. Self-renewing HSCs reside at the apex of this hierarchy and produce all blood lineages, including the erythroid lineage that forms red blood cells, the megakaryocytic lineage that gives rise to platelets, and the myeloid and lymphoid lineages that generate cells of the innate and adaptive immune systems. 27/05/2024 Duración: 59minHugues de ThéCollège de FranceOncologie cellulaire et moléculaireAnnée 2023-2024Exploring the World of Protein Post-translational ModificationsConférence - Tony Hunter : New Insights into Intercellular Crosstalk between Different Cell Populations in Pancreatic Tumors That Can Be Translated into the ClinicTony HunterSalk Institute, La Jolla, California, USARésuméPancreatic adenocarcinoma (PDA) is one of the most lethal cancers, primarily due to late diagnosis. PDA is a highly stromal (desmoplastic) and poorly vascularized tumor with a dense extracellular matrix; only ~10% of the cells in the tumor are tumor cells, with the rest of the tumor microenvironment (TME) being comprised of cancer-associated fibroblasts (CAFs, and immune cells, including tumor-associated macrophages (TAMs).
